See below a downloadable pdf resource by Epilepsy Scotland talking about the side effects of Anti-Epileptic Drugs (AEDs), including more information about the following topics:

 

Common side effects – this includes lethargy, drowsiness, tiredness, dizziness, headaches, and weight gain / loss.

 

Side effects to watch out for – side effects such as rashes should be brought up to your doctor immediately

 

Ways to cut down side effects – Change the drug and / or quantity of the drug

 

Osteoporosis and osteomalacia – Long term usage of AEDs can increase the risk of brittle or thinning bones

 

Also includes more information about the Yellow Card reporting scheme, and reliable sources of internet research.
